Key to the species of
Malukandra
[adapted from
Santos-Silva et al. (2010)
]
1. Dorsal surface of head finely punctate between eyes in both sexes.
Papua New Guinea
............ ..............................................
M. hornabrooki
Santos-Silva, Heffern and Matsuda, 2010
—
Dorsal surface of head coarsely punctate between eyes in both sexes........................................
2
2(1). Male mandible not falciform, without distinct concavity at inner margin. Pronotum coarsely punctate in both sexes. Metatarsomere V not notably slender at basal half in both sexes.
Indonesia
(
Sulawesi
?, Halmahera). .....................................
M. heterostyla
(
Lameere, 1902
)
— Male mandible sub-falciform, with distinct concavity at inner margin. Metatarsomere V distinctly slender at basal half. Female unknown.
Indonesia
(
Irian Jaya
). .............................................. ............................................
M. jayawijayana
Santos-Silva, Heffern and Matsuda, 2010
